CBSE: A national curriculum with focus on Science and Math through a structured, examination focus, better suited for competitive examinations in India.
ICSE: A balanced curriculum with strong emphasis on English, Arts and Science. It promotes an understanding of concepts and an analysis of concepts.
IB (International Baccalaureate): A global curriculum that facilitates inquiry based learning through a holistic approach including critical thinking, and a global-mindedness.
Cambridge (IGCSE/A Levels): A flexible international curriculum with subject choices and more analytical focus than the other curricula. It is more suited for students wanting to go to our international universities.

The majority of schools commence their Nursery admissions at 2.5 to 3.5 years of age.
Admissions usually begin from October and continue until February each academic year.
You will require the child's birth certificate, at least three passport-sized photographs, and previous school records if applicable.
